**The Grain’s Language: Beyond Surface Aesthetics** Every wood species speaks in a dialect of fibers, knots, and density gradients. The difference between a flat, decorative piece and a dynamic sculpture lies in interpreting this language. A piece of quarter-sawn oak, for instance, might appear rigid at first glance, but skilled hands learn to follow the grain’s subtle undulations—its natural bow, twist, or spiral—as if reading a hidden blueprint. This isn’t just about avoiding splits; it’s about aligning the sculpture’s motion with the wood’s intrinsic rhythm.

Technology has entered this domain not as a crutch, but as a diagnostic tool. Finite element analysis (FEA) software lets sculptors simulate load distributions and optimize joint integrity before a single chisel strikes. Yet, nothing replaces the sensory feedback of live wood—its dampness, vibration under pressure, the subtle shift when a knife glides through a knot. Climate change has altered wood availability—drought-stressed trees produce denser, more brittle grain, while rising humidity fosters fungal risks.

This has forced a renaissance in sustainable sourcing and reclaimed materials. Top studios now integrate lifecycle mapping into their design process, tracking carbon footprint from forest to finished form. A 2023 study by the International Woodworkers’ Alliance found that 78% of leading sculptors now prioritize FSC-certified or reclaimed timber, not only for environmental ethics but for superior grain consistency.
